6th Annual Health Fair for the Whole Family

St. Barnabas Presbyterian Church will hold its 6th Annual Health Fair on Saturday, August 20, 10 a.m. to 1 p.m., at the church, 1220 W. Belt Line Road in Richardson.

Partnering once again with Richardson High School nurses, the planning committee realizes the importance of sharing with our community health and safety information, specific resources and access to health care workers. RHS nurse Kathleen Keys explains, “We recruit wellness and safety providers whose purpose is to empower people to find the resources they need to take responsibility for their own well-being.”

Free school immunizations for children eligible for Medicaid or Children's Health Insurance Plan (CHIP), “Ask the Doctor,” cholesterol and blood pressure check, body mass index, hearing and vision tests, CHIP enrollment, dental health, and bike helmets will be featured again this year. Other information booths include:

               Disaster Preparedness – Medical Reserve Corps of Dallas

               Genesis Women’s Outreach information

               Ask the Pediatrician – Dr. Daphne Favroth, Clinic for Family Health & Wellness

               Poison Control – North Texas Poison Center

               The Warren House – Resource for children with special needs and/or developmental delays

               Movement Disorders – Presbyterian Hospital – problems experienced by children and adults alike

This Health Fair is for the whole community, regardless of age or economic status.
